    Hi Bodkins, i paid £5,200 ppi and i hoped the interest etc would make it up to about 6 thousand. i had settled the loan after re-mortgaging and recieved around £500 rebate. In the end i got £5490 which i was pretty happy with all things considered.

    Spoke to Deloittes today and they have received all the info required from our Mortgage company (regarding interest rates etc etc). They said it can now be passed back to the FSCS for an investigator to look at and we should hear back from the FSCS in around 3 weeks time. Fingers crossed!!! xxx
